Tangierine Café in the Morocco pavilion still isn’t serving its original Quick Service menu, but the dining location continues to act as an Epcot festival spot — the Tangierine Café: Flavors of the Medina booth.
The marketplace is known for selling traditional Moroccan-inspired cuisine, like grilled kebabs and a variety of alcoholic and non-alcoholic beverages.
Believe it or not, but we actually loved every single item at this booth. It was our favorite of the entire festival!
You can’t go wrong with any of these items. You even get a lot of bang for your buck, especially with the flatbread.
What also makes this spot nice is the many tables and chairs provided for guests.

Overview
Location: Morocco pavilion
Nearby booths: Hanami, La Isla Fresca
Nearby seating areas: There is indoor seating inside Tangierine Café, including plenty of outdoor seating. Plus, Restaurant Marrakesh (in the back of the pavilion) is being used as an indoor seating area.
Not to miss: Everything

Mediterranean Flatbread
Mediterranean Flatbread with za’atar, artichokes, olives, mozzarella, and feta cheese. This is a new 2022 festival item.
Price: $5.75
Special Diets: N/A
Rating: 4.8/5
Our Thoughts
Shannon: What an incredible deal. So many great flavors and for not much money.
Heather: Frick yeah! So good. Love the combinations of flavors. This isn’t your “typical” flatbread!
Felicia: The Za’atar sauce is strongly spiced and not my favorite but the flatbread otherwise is delicious. It’s also a good portion for the price and great option for non-meat eaters.
Allyson: So good! Loved this. Great flavor and fresh. Great bang for your buck.

Harissa Chicken Grilled Kebab
Harissa Chicken Grilled Kebab with Carrot-Chickpea Salad and Garlic Aïoli.
Price: $5.75
Special Diets: Gluten-Friendly
Rating: 5/5
Our Thoughts
Shannon: Incredibly tender chicken. Delicious flavors. Loved.
Heather: Yes it is “just” chicken but man is it good! Amazing flame kissed flavors of yumminess!
Felicia: Delicious chicken. It’s tender and delicious. The chickpea and carrot salad is both sweet and spiced and complements the chicken well. Nice portion.
